Bug#451304: libc6: iconv(1) should document //translit and //ignore too
Package: libc6
Version: 2.6.1-6
Severity: wishlist
Hello,
Documentation for //translit and //ignore can be found in iconv_open(3),
but non-C-programmers people will probably never read it but just read
iconv(1), so iconv(1) should document it too.
